Oshino, a charming village located near Mount Fuji, offers a unique blend of natural beauty and traditional culture. One of the main attractions in Oshino is the Oshino Hakkai, a series of eight ponds fed by the melting snow from Mount Fuji. These ponds are known for their crystal-clear waters and diverse aquatic life, making them a peaceful spot for a leisurely walk and photography. Visitors can also enjoy the surrounding scenery, which beautifully showcases the iconic mountain.
Another notable aspect of Oshino is its traditional architecture. The village features well-preserved thatched-roof houses that provide a glimpse into Japan's rural past. Strolling through the village allows you to appreciate the serene atmosphere and perhaps even encounter local artisans.
